CHANGES.md view
@@ -1,3 +1,23 @@+## Changes in version 1.11.0++  * Add support for linking identifiers with a quote between backticks (#1408)++## Changes in version 1.10.0++  * Add support for labeled module references (#1360)+## Changes in version 1.9.0++ * Fix build-time regression for `base < 4.7` (#1119)++ * Update parsing to strip whitespace from table cells (#1074)++## Changes in version 1.8.0++ * Support inline markup in markdown-style links (#875)++ * Remove now unused `Documentation.Haddock.Utf8` module.+   This module was anyways copied from the `utf8-string` package.+ ## Changes in version 1.7.0   * Make `Documentation.Haddock.Parser.Monad` an internal module

+ src/Documentation/Haddock/Parser/Identifier.hs view
@@ -0,0 +1,159 @@+{-# LANGUAGE BangPatterns #-}+-- |+-- Module      :  Documentation.Haddock.Parser.Identifier+-- Copyright   :  (c) Alec Theriault 2019,+-- License     :  BSD-like+--+-- Maintainer  :  haddock@projects.haskell.org+-- Stability   :  experimental+-- Portability :  portable+--+-- Functionality for parsing identifiers and operators++module Documentation.Haddock.Parser.Identifier (+  Identifier(..),+  parseValid,+) where++import Documentation.Haddock.Types           ( Namespace(..) )+import Documentation.Haddock.Parser.Monad+import qualified Text.Parsec as Parsec+import           Text.Parsec.Pos             ( updatePosChar )+import           Text.Parsec                 ( State(..)+                                             , getParserState, setParserState )++import Data.Text (Text)+import qualified Data.Text as T++import           Data.Char (isAlpha, isAlphaNum)+import Control.Monad (guard)+import Data.Maybe+import CompatPrelude++-- | Identifier string surrounded with namespace, opening, and closing quotes/backticks.+data Identifier = Identifier !Namespace !Char String !Char+  deriving (Show, Eq)++parseValid :: Parser Identifier+parseValid = do+  s@State{ stateInput = inp, statePos = pos } <- getParserState++  case takeIdentifier inp of+    Nothing -> Parsec.parserFail "parseValid: Failed to match a valid identifier"+    Just (ns, op, ident, cl, inp') ->+      let posOp = updatePosChar pos op+          posIdent = T.foldl updatePosChar posOp ident+          posCl = updatePosChar posIdent cl+          s' = s{ stateInput = inp', statePos = posCl }+      in setParserState s' $> Identifier ns op (T.unpack ident) cl+++-- | Try to parse a delimited identifier off the front of the given input.+--+-- This tries to match as many valid Haskell identifiers/operators as possible,+-- to the point of sometimes accepting invalid things (ex: keywords). Some+-- considerations:+--+--   - operators and identifiers can have module qualifications+--   - operators can be wrapped in parens (for prefix)+--   - identifiers can be wrapped in backticks (for infix)+--   - delimiters are backticks or regular ticks+--   - since regular ticks are also valid in identifiers, we opt for the+--     longest successful parse+--+-- This function should make /O(1)/ allocations+takeIdentifier :: Text -> Maybe (Namespace, Char, Text, Char, Text)+takeIdentifier input = listToMaybe $ do++    -- Optional namespace+    let (ns, input') = case T.uncons input of+                         Just ('v', i) -> (Value, i)+                         Just ('t', i) -> (Type, i)+                         _             -> (None, input)++    -- Opening tick+    (op, input'') <- maybeToList (T.uncons input')+    guard (op == '\'' || op == '`')++    -- Identifier/operator+    (ident, input''') <- wrapped input''++    -- Closing tick+    (cl, input'''') <- maybeToList (T.uncons input''')+    guard (cl == '\'' || cl == '`')++    return (ns, op, ident, cl, input'''')++  where++    -- | Parse out a wrapped, possibly qualified, operator or identifier+    wrapped t = do+      (c, t'  ) <- maybeToList (T.uncons t)+      -- Tuples+      case c of+        '(' | Just (c', _) <- T.uncons t'+            , c' == ',' || c' == ')'+            -> do let (commas, t'') = T.span (== ',') t'+                  (')', t''') <- maybeToList (T.uncons t'')+                  return (T.take (T.length commas + 2) t, t''')++        -- Parenthesized+        '(' -> do (n,   t'' ) <- general False 0 [] t'+                  (')', t''') <- maybeToList (T.uncons t'')+                  return (T.take (n + 2) t, t''')++        -- Backticked+        '`' -> do (n,   t'' ) <- general False 0 [] t'+                  ('`', t''') <- maybeToList (T.uncons t'')+                  return (T.take (n + 2) t, t''')++        -- Unadorned+        _   -> do (n,   t'' ) <- general False 0 [] t+                  return (T.take n t, t'')++    -- | Parse out a possibly qualified operator or identifier+    general :: Bool           -- ^ refuse inputs starting with operators+            -> Int            -- ^ total characters \"consumed\" so far+            -> [(Int, Text)]  -- ^ accumulated results+            -> Text           -- ^ current input+            -> [(Int, Text)]  -- ^ total characters parsed & what remains+    general !identOnly !i acc t+      -- Starts with an identifier (either just an identifier, or a module qual)+      | Just (n, rest) <- identLike t+      = if T.null rest+          then acc+          else case T.head rest of+                 '`' -> (n + i, rest) : acc+                 ')' -> (n + i, rest) : acc+                 '.' -> general False (n + i + 1) acc (T.tail rest)+                 '\'' -> let (m, rest') = quotes rest+                         in general True (n + m + 1 + i) ((n + m + i, rest') : acc) (T.tail rest')+                 _ -> acc++      -- An operator+      | Just (n, rest) <- optr t+      , not identOnly+      = (n + i, rest) : acc++      -- Anything else+      | otherwise+      = acc++    -- | Parse an identifier off the front of the input+    identLike t+      | T.null t = Nothing+      | isAlpha (T.head t) || '_' == T.head t+      = let !(idt, rest) = T.span (\c -> isAlphaNum c || c == '_') t+            !(octos, rest') = T.span (== '#') rest+      in Just (T.length idt + T.length octos, rest')+      | otherwise = Nothing++    -- | Parse all but the last quote off the front of the input+    -- PRECONDITION: T.head t `elem` ['\'', '`']+    quotes :: Text -> (Int, Text)+    quotes t = let !n = T.length (T.takeWhile (`elem` ['\'', '`']) t) - 1+               in (n, T.drop n t)++    -- | Parse an operator off the front of the input+    optr t = let !(op, rest) = T.span isSymbolChar t+             in if T.null op then Nothing else Just (T.length op, rest)
